Human Rights Watch warns on China’s proposed ethnic unity law

A report by Human Rights Watch warned that a proposed Chinese law on ethnic unity could expand repression and forced assimilation of minorities. The draft, linked to ideas promoted by Xi Jinping, may formalise ideological control and weaken language rights. HRW's Maya Wang said minorities like Tibetans and Uyghurs could face stronger state pressure.
